PB 電子会議室
発言No. | 更新日 | 題名(クリックすると発言内容と関連するコメントが表示されます) |
---|---|---|
1687 | 98/06/05 09:19:39 | RE(6):DB OLEコントロールにBlob型(Long Raw型)を読んでます By てとらぽっと |
1641 | 98/06/02 14:39:31 | RE(5):レコード単位に添付ファイルって付けれます? By まこと |
1638 | 98/06/02 13:51:54 | RE(4):レコード単位に添付ファイルって付けれます? By あすかちゃんの父 |
1637 | 98/06/02 13:20:25 | RE(3):レコード単位に添付ファイルって付けれます? By M.M |
1636 | 98/06/02 13:02:48 | RE(2):レコード単位に添付ファイルって付けれます? By まこと |
1635 | 98/06/02 10:54:45 | RE(1):レコード単位に添付ファイルって付けれます? By あすかちゃんの父 |
1634 | 98/06/02 09:37:00 | レコード単位に添付ファイルって付けれます? By まこと |
カテゴリ:旧電子会議室
日付:1998年06月02日 13:20 発信者:M.M
題名:RE(3):レコード単位に添付ファイルって付けれます?
「まこと」さん、こんにちは。
>>>PBに限定しなくてもいいんですが、障害等 登録データ毎に添付ファイルを登録する事は
>>>可能でしょうか?
>>
>>これは、Word、Excel etc のファイルをRDBMSに登録するということですね?
>>それならば、PBではblob型でファイルを読込んで、RDBMSのバイナリデータを
>>扱えるカラム(SQL AnywhereならLong Binary)にINSERTすればできます。
>
>Oracle7.3では、Long Rawでした。
>PBからLong Raw型のTableは作れますが、DWがサポートしていません。
DatawindowのOLEカラムをOracleのLong Raw型に割り当て、そのOLEカラムにExcelとかWordの
データを入れてやれば実現できると思います。
>>>DBに格納先を登録して、ファイルサーバから読み込んで起動(Run)って事を提案すると、
>>>Web やOODBへの移行っていう手もあるんじゃないのかと言われました。
>>>Web で、どうやって実現するのか・・・
昔PowerBuilder V3.xの頃に、ビットマップファイルをファイルサーバに格納して、Oracleにはファイル名
だけ記録しておくシステムの事例がありました。ビットマップがWord/Excelのファイル名に変わっただけで
同じパターンですね。
Webで実現するのは、ActiveXコントロールを使えばそれほど難しくないと思います。
(HTMLの中にWord/Excelを扱うActiveXを埋め込んでおいて、クリックするとWord/Excelが起動する...
こんなイメージですかね?)
付加情報:
PowerBuilder Version (記載なし)
Client SoftWare
OS (記載なし)
DBMS (記載なし)
Browser (記載なし)
Server SoftWare
O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)
Copyright © 2013 Power Future Co., Ltd.